A telethermometer, also known as a telethermocouple, is a type of thermometer that uses a thermocouple to measure temperature remotely. In the context of a pyrogen test, which is a test to detect fever-causing substances, a telethermometer can be used to monitor the temperature of a test solution or a biological sample from a distance.
During a pyrogen test, substances are injected into the sample being tested to see if they induce a fever response. By using a telethermometer, the temperature of the sample can be continuously monitored without the need for physical contact, ensuring accurate and real-time temperature readings. This remote monitoring capability is particularly useful in maintaining the integrity of the test and minimizing the risk of contamination or interference with the sample. Additionally, it allows for greater convenience and efficiency in conducting the test, as researchers can monitor multiple samples simultaneously from a central location.
